Crystal clear depth
The razor sharp ultraHD Photo Print are exhibited perfectly under acrylic glass. Your photoart will shine in vibrant colors and, depending on the thickness of the glass, will display a subtle to eye-catching 3D effect.

The light, shatterproof material enhances the appearance, making the colours and depth really pop. The 3 mm aluminium Dibond backing consists of two layers of aluminium sandwiched around a polyethylene core. This completes the overall look while providing additional stability. Perfectly balanced colors on Fuji Crystal Professional Archive Maxima papir.

Choose from 2 mm or 4 mm acrylic glass for sizes up to 120×180 cm. We recommend the 4 mm for more depth.

For sizes over 120×180 2 mm are available.

Display it just as it is using the hidden rail on the backside or choose mounting in 20 mm art aluminium case in black, grey, gold or white.

Poul Erik Christensen is a photographer whose camera is his brush. He wants to bring you a perspective, create a corridor to a creative universe that puzzels your mind, touch the creative part of you, makes you feel positive, happy, and curious, raise awareness and start a dialogue about how inspiring nature is and how essential it is for our survival in more ways than we think about. He believes in utopia and abundance and thinks that art should create curious and positive feelings in order for us to support the abundance in our lives. To truly change the way we care too little about nature, his work reflects how he finds inspiration and appreciates and thanks to nature for its positive effect on his art and his life.

Poul Erik Christensen began his lifelong passion in 1991. He never planned to be a photographer, but a trip around the world in 1989 created a spark. He comes from a creative family. Through the years, he has done almost everything in photography in Denmark and around Europe. Many years ago, he was given the opportunity to capture art for a business and that kickstarted his creations. His artworks are now a part of many private collections.
